We stayed in the family suite, room 8181, which is probably intended for parents and 3 children, but we made do just fine! There was plenty of room for storage and the balcony is to die for! Plus it's a great location to get anywhere on the ship. Some of the best activities we did were the trivia games, Dancing with the Stripes, theme parties, Top Chef at Sea, the galley tour, backstage tour with the singers and dancers (they were wonderful1) and The Newlywed not so newlywed game show. Most evenings we ate in the main dining room for late seating. It did get very late to eat though and the buffet was just as good for dinner. None of us ate at the specialty dining restaurants, but heard positive reviews on them. The gym is smaller than on most ships, and no outside access from it which was a bit frustrating.
